Jordan e-Visa can be issued for either two months, three months, six months, one year, or five years.
A Jordan visa with a two-month validity period enables only one entry to the country, while a three-month visa covers two entries to Jordan.
The remaining six-month, one-year, and five-year visas are issued as multiple-entry visas, which means that they can be used for numerous visits to Jordan.
According to the Jordan visa requirements, a transit visa for Jordan is not necessary if a traveler holds an onward travel ticket confirming their connecting flight within 48 hours of arriving in Jordan.
If your transit stop exceeds 48 hours, you can apply for a transit e-Visa, which allows for a 72-hour layover in Jordan.

The Jordan e-Visa is an electronic visa that can be obtained online by nationals of eligible countries who wish to visit Jordan for tourism, business, study, or medical treatment-related purposes.
No. The Jordan Pass is a travel package that enables free entry to around 40 different tourist locations in Jordan. Before traveling to Jordan, you should obtain both documents, i.e., a Jordan visa and a Jordan Pass.
There are only around 10 countries that can travel to Jordan and stay there without a visa for a certain period of time. These visa-exempt countries include all GCC member states. Yes. Children traveling to Jordan do need to hold a valid Jordan visa too. The application on behalf of every underage traveler can be submitted by the parent or legal guardian.
Depending on your nationality, you may be asked to provide various documents, including a valid passport or travel document valid for at least 6 months from the planned entry to Jordan, a residence permit copy, the application owner or sponsor's passport copy, a copy of a valid professions license.
